2025 Chevrolet Traverse Reviews Summary

Redesigned in 2024, the 2025 Traverse gets a few additional changes. The base LS trim level disappears and the upscale High Country trim level is new. Chevrolet also makes the formerly optional Trailering Package standard equipment—so it’s easier to take advantage of the Traverse’s 5,000-pound towing capacity—and a new Sun and Wheel Package is available. Those updates broaden this Chevy’s appeal but do not address perceived quality issues related to the powertrain and interior materials.

Verdict: Chevy gets a lot of things right with the 2025 Traverse. However, there are head-scratchers related to quality and usability. From the unpleasant engine note and cheap interior plastics to the fussy wiper controls and aggravating third-row folding process, the Traverse regularly draws unfavorable attention to itself.

2025 Cadillac Escalade Reviews Summary

The 2025 Cadillac Escalade maintains the momentum of one of the most recognizable SUV nameplates. The current-generation Escalade was introduced as a 2021 model, but for 2025 it gets a refresh that includes styling changes and a redesigned dashboard display. The all-electric 2025 Cadillac Escalade IQ joins the lineup as well, but that’s covered in a separate review. This gasoline Escalade competes against full-size luxury SUVs like the BMW X7, Infiniti QX80, Land Rover Range Rover, Lexus LX, Lincoln Navigator, and Mercedes-Benz GLS-Class.

Verdict: If you’re willing to spend extra on a well-optioned example, the Escalade is a credible luxury vehicle. But its platform’s shortcomings can’t be erased.

Look and feel

2025 Chevrolet Traverse

7/10

2025 Cadillac Escalade

9/10

The 2025 Chevrolet Traverse showcased a commendable exterior design, aligning with Chevrolet's recent trend of stylish SUVs. Its interior followed suit with digital instrumentation and a Google-based infotainment system, offering an appealing layout. However, the quality of materials used inside did not match the visual appeal. The hard, glossy plastic and Evotex artificial leather detracted from the overall sense of luxury, especially given the Traverse's price point. Despite these shortcomings, the Traverse offered a range of trims, including the off-road-oriented Z71, which came with features like Radiant Red paint and a panoramic sunroof, pushing its MSRP to $55,900.

In contrast, the 2025 Cadillac Escalade continued to embody Cadillac's luxury ethos, with its updated design further distinguishing it from its platform-sharing siblings, the Chevrolet Tahoe/Suburban and GMC Yukon/Yukon XL. The Escalade's new front end and vertical headlights aligned it with Cadillac's EV lineup, while its massive 24-inch wheels emphasized its imposing presence. Inside, Cadillac worked to mask the shared platform with a screen-centric interior, now boasting a 55-inch display spanning the dashboard. The Escalade offered a range of trims, with the Premium Luxury Platinum model featuring an illuminated Cadillac crest and grille surround. The interior was adorned with real leather and curated motifs, enhancing its luxury appeal.

Performance

2025 Chevrolet Traverse

6/10

2025 Cadillac Escalade

6/10

The 2025 Chevrolet Traverse was powered by a 2.5-liter turbocharged four-cylinder engine, producing 328 horsepower and 326 pound-feet of torque. While the engine provided ample power, its exhaust note was less than refined. The Traverse's AWD system allowed for controlled acceleration, and the Z71 trim offered off-road capabilities with increased ground clearance and all-terrain tires. Despite its size, the Traverse managed a combined fuel economy of 21.5 mpg, slightly exceeding its EPA rating.

The 2025 Cadillac Escalade, on the other hand, was equipped with a naturally-aspirated 6.2-liter V8 engine, delivering 420 horsepower and 460 pound-feet of torque. The Escalade-V variant boasted a supercharged V8 with 682 horsepower. All models featured a 10-speed automatic transmission, ensuring smooth power delivery. While the Escalade's RWD and optional 4WD systems provided versatility, its off-road capabilities were limited compared to some competitors. The Escalade's ride quality was enhanced by Magnetic Ride Control, though it couldn't match the handling of unibody SUVs. The brakes, while adequate, could benefit from the optional Brembo upgrade.

Form and function

2025 Chevrolet Traverse

7/10

2025 Cadillac Escalade

9/10

The 2025 Chevrolet Traverse offered generous interior space, with seating for up to eight passengers. The front seats were comfortable, and the Z71 trim included heated seats and a heated steering wheel. The second-row captain's chairs provided good support, though the lack of window shades was a drawback. The third row was adequate for adults, but visibility was limited. Cargo space was impressive, with up to 97.6 cubic feet available with the second row folded, though folding the third row required some maneuvering.

The 2025 Cadillac Escalade provided ample space in both its standard and long-wheelbase ESV configurations. The ESV offered increased cargo space and third-row legroom. The Escalade's interior was spacious, with best-in-class first-row headroom and legroom. Cargo capacity was also impressive, with the ESV offering up to 142.8 cubic feet. The Escalade's towing capacity was competitive, though it lacked some of the towing features offered by rivals.

Technology

2025 Chevrolet Traverse

10/10

2025 Cadillac Escalade

9/10

The 2025 Chevrolet Traverse featured a standard 17.7-inch touchscreen infotainment system with Google Built-in, offering navigation, voice recognition, and app access. It also included wireless Apple CarPlay and Android Auto, a Wi-Fi hotspot, and SiriusXM radio. The digital instrumentation panel provided customizable views, and optional features like a digital rearview mirror and surround-view camera system enhanced convenience.

The 2025 Cadillac Escalade boasted a 55-inch display spanning the dashboard, incorporating a digital instrument cluster and infotainment touchscreen. A 19-speaker AKG audio system was standard, with a 36-speaker upgrade available. The Escalade retained wireless Apple CarPlay and Android Auto, and its voice recognition system, while not as advanced as some competitors, was functional. The optional Executive Second Row Package added rear-seat entertainment and additional controls, enhancing passenger comfort.

Safety

2025 Chevrolet Traverse

9/10

2025 Cadillac Escalade

6/10

The 2025 Chevrolet Traverse came equipped with a comprehensive suite of driver aids, including adaptive cruise control, automatic emergency braking, and lane-keep assist. The Enhanced Driving Package added Super Cruise, a hands-free driving system, and remote-parking technology. The Traverse received a five-star overall safety rating from the NHTSA and a "Top Safety Pick" award from the IIHS.

The 2025 Cadillac Escalade also featured a robust array of safety technologies, such as adaptive cruise control, blind-spot monitoring, and a 360-degree camera system. Super Cruise was available, offering hands-free driving on mapped roads. While crash-test ratings were not available at the time of publication, the Escalade's safety features were comprehensive.
